When teacher Steve Stefanski toured schools in South Africa this
summer, he noticed the large class sizes, lack of chalk and the barbed
wire. Stefanski, who teaches economics, world history and U.S. history at
Romeoville High School, visited the KwaZulu-Natal Province in South
Africa as part of a 16-day study tour sponsored by the Council for
Economic Education through a grant from the U.S. Department of
Education.

An audience gathered Saturday at the place where a deadly tornado cut a path exactly 20 years earlier, a place to remember lives lost, lives changed, a community brought together, and a community rebuilt. The commemoration ceremony began at 3 p.m. on the west side of the DuPage River south of Lockport Street. The tornado passed through here, from the northwest to the southeast, around 3:30 p.m. Aug. 28, 1990.
